Founder’s Roundtable

Founder's Roundtable inspires faculty entrepreneurship in conjunction with Global Entrepreneurship Week at Northeastern. The event features professors Thomas Webster, Rupal Patel, and Sidi Bencherif who will discuss the motivation behind their ventures, the challenges they face bringing tech to industry, and the incentives powering their success. James Sherley, Founder and Director of Asymmetrex, will moderate the roundtable.
